Hello, i purchased flash objects vol1 vol2 and vol3. When i insert a .swf file in my project and i push the play button the video is lagging alot. It only does that with flash .swf files. I have a very good computer i dont understand.. can someone help me with that please? Is there any way to freeze the flash video track? Thanks!

Thanks Ken you game me an idea. I had the files in a different directory. I moved them to the default directory and voila, all is well.
